In the first decade of the 20th century, which city would have been most impacted by the oil industry in Texas?

Social Studies
1 answer:
Lena [83]3 years ago
3 0
Discovery of the Powell Field, also near Corsicana, followed in 1900. Jan. 10, 1901, is the most famous date in Texas petroleum history. This is the date that the great gusher erupted in the oil well being drilled at Spindletop, near Beaumont, by a mining engineer, Capt. A. F.

In which u.S. City did the term black friday originate?
natulia [17]

Answer:

Philadelphia in the state of Pennsylvania, USA.

Explanation:

The term "Black Friday" more generally meant the huge number of shoppers on the day after Thanksgiving which falls on the last Friday of November. This phenomena of shoppers thronging the shops in huge numbers led to the terminology of "Black Friday" as it also refers to the huge traffic snarls and pedestrians who are out shopping. This day also is regarded as the first day of 'Christmas shopping', where people start their shopping for the upcoming Christmas celebration.

The Pennsylvanian state of Philadelphia is believed to be the place of origin for this "Black Friday" term when in around 1961 when the people noticed a huge traffic block due to the huge number of shoppers/ pedestrians on that day right after the Thanksgiving festival. This then came to be labelled as a regular phenomenon, and with the huge advantage f attracting customers, shops began giving huge offers and various discounts for this particular day, further increasing the significance of the day.
